Planting Calendar for Polygonums

Frost tolerance for polygonums: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ost.

It's not a good idea to plant polygonums until after the last frost has passed because they do not do well in cold weather.

The earliest that you can plant polygonums in Senatobia is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ant polygonums and expect a good harvest is probably August. If you wait any later than that and your polygonums may not have a chance to really do well. You can get started a couple of weeks earlier by starting your polygonums indoors.

Last Frost Date

On average all chance of frost has passed is on April 15 in Senatobia. In the coldest months of winter you can expect an average low temperature of 5°F.

Remember that USDA zone info for Senatobia is an average and the actual date of last frost is different every year. Half of the time in Senatobia there is a last frost after April 15 so be sure to be ready to protect your polygonums in the event of a late frost.
